Origin, the UK’s leading manufacturer of premium aluminium windows and doors, has launched its groundbreaking OW-70 Soho Window.
The exceptional design sets a new standard for steel-look aesthetics and performance, and empowers its trade Partners to elevate their offerings and capitalise on the growing demand for statement glazing.
The OW-70 Soho Window delivers an authentic industrial look with its slim sightlines, square beading and true glazing divides. This meticulously crafted design also features superior thermal performance, which surpasses traditional steel windows and building regulations.

– Authentic steel-look aesthetics: True glazing divides, ultra-slim sightlines of just 65mm and square beading
– Superior thermal performance: U-Values as low as 1.4 W/m2K which exceeds building regulations, ensuring energy efficiency and lower energy bills
– Unrivalled versatility: Available in casement, fixed frame and bay window configurations, can be specified in over 150 RAL colours including textured finishes, and is backed by an industry-leading guarantee of up to 20-years
– Unbeatable quality: Made bespoke using the highest-grade aluminium and powder coated to Qualicoat’s rigorous standard at Origin’s UK factories
– Seamless integration: Complements Origin’s existing Soho Collection, allowing trade Partners to offer a complete and cohesive solution to homeowners
